Output 67c1a42640a761e23f968bf6df921e62411a3cb58343af697e0a7673fcc510c6:0

value
24770656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a03a99121238fb32ae34e9d88ebc40ec4327194 OP_EQUAL
address
3BMZwLtfBAzNBTzi4ix6DPeMNJJsKrQ7gD
transaction
67c1a42640a761e23f968bf6df921e62411a3cb58343af697e0a7673fcc510c6
confirmations
320824
spent
true